The Australia motherboard market is driven by increasing demand for high-performance computing systems, gaming setups, and data centers. As local consumers and businesses continue to adopt advanced technologies, the demand for motherboards with greater processing capacity, enhanced connectivity, and integrated graphics is growing. Additionally, the rise in DIY PC building culture and e-sports is further boosting this market. Government investments in digital infrastructure and local manufacturing initiatives are also playing a crucial role in shaping this sector.
The Australia motherboard market is experiencing steady growth driven by the rise in gaming culture, increased adoption of high-performance computing, and the growing demand for personal and business desktops. The shift toward compact, energy-efficient motherboards and integration with high-speed processors is reshaping design trends. Additionally, the market is influenced by the surge in demand for motherboards compatible with AI and machine learning applications.
The Australia motherboard market faces significant challenges stemming from global semiconductor shortages, which continue to impact supply chains and increase production costs. The dominance of international brands and manufacturers puts local vendors at a competitive disadvantage, especially in terms of pricing and product innovation. Additionally, rapid technological obsolescence requires continuous research and development, which can be costly for smaller players. Market saturation and the increasing popularity of integrated systems like laptops and tablets further reduce the demand for standalone motherboards.
The Australia motherboard market offers promising investment avenues through the increasing demand for gaming PCs, AI workstations, and custom-built computers. Investors can explore partnerships with local PC assemblers, online retailers, and gaming cafés. There is also potential in investing in R&D for eco-friendly and energy-efficient motherboard designs, especially as sustainability becomes a priority for tech-savvy consumers.
Government policies in Australia that impact the motherboard market primarily focus on the regulation of electronics imports and technology innovation. The Australian government has stringent rules regarding the importation of electronic goods, including motherboards, which often involve compliance with safety standards and environmental regulations. Policies aimed at reducing carbon footprints and promoting sustainability impact the production and disposal of electronic components, requiring manufacturers to adopt environmentally friendly practices. Furthermore, incentives for local innovation and R&D, especially in the tech industry, can influence the competitiveness of local motherboard manufacturers, though these policies are often more geared towards broader tech sectors.
